### ✅ **COMPLETED - Phase 1: Core VS Code Tool Provider (August 23, 2025)**
|
||||
|
||||
## Testing Strategy
|
||||
**Successfully Implemented & Tested:**
|
||||
|
||||
- ✅ VSCodeToolProvider module with 12 core tools
|
||||
- ✅ VSCodePermissions system with 6 permission levels
|
||||
- ✅ Integration with UnifiedMCPServer tool discovery and routing
|
||||
- ✅ Security controls: path sandboxing, command whitelisting, audit logging
|
||||
- ✅ Agent coordination integration (tasks, assignments, coordination)
|
||||
|
||||
**Working Tools:**
|
||||
|
||||
- ✅ File Operations: `vscode_read_file`, `vscode_write_file`, `vscode_create_file`, `vscode_delete_file`, `vscode_list_directory`
|
||||
- ✅ Editor Operations: `vscode_get_active_editor`, `vscode_set_editor_content`, `vscode_get_selection`, `vscode_set_selection`
|
||||
- ✅ Commands: `vscode_run_command`, `vscode_show_message`
|
||||
- ✅ Workspace: `vscode_get_workspace_folders`
|
||||
|
||||
**Key Achievement:** VS Code tools now work seamlessly alongside external MCP servers through unified agent coordination!

### 🔄 **CURRENT PRIORITY - Phase 1.5: VS Code Extension API Bridge**
|
||||
|
||||
**Status:** Tools currently return placeholder data. Need to implement actual VS Code Extension API calls.
|
||||
|
||||
**Implementation Steps:**
|
||||
|
||||
1. **JavaScript Bridge Module** - Create communication layer between Elixir and VS Code Extension API
|
||||
2. **Real API Integration** - Replace placeholder responses with actual VS Code API calls
|
||||
3. **Error Handling** - Robust error handling for VS Code API failures
|
||||
4. **Testing** - Verify all tools work with real VS Code operations
|
||||
|
||||
**Target Completion:** Next 2-3 days

### 📅 **UPDATED IMPLEMENTATION TIMELINE**
|
||||
|
||||
#### **Phase 2: Language Services & Advanced Editor Operations (Priority: High)**
|
||||
|
||||
**Target:** Week of August 26, 2025
|
||||
|
||||
**Tools to Implement:**
|
||||
|
||||
- `vscode_get_diagnostics` - Get language server diagnostics
|
||||
- `vscode_format_document` - Format current document
|
||||
- `vscode_format_selection` - Format selected text
|
||||
- `vscode_find_references` - Find symbol references
|
||||
- `vscode_go_to_definition` - Navigate to definition
|
||||
- `vscode_rename_symbol` - Rename symbols across workspace
|
||||
- `vscode_code_actions` - Get available code actions
|
||||
- `vscode_apply_code_action` - Apply specific code action
|
||||
|
||||
**Value:** Enables agents to perform intelligent code analysis and refactoring
|
||||
|
||||
#### **Phase 3: Search, Navigation & Workspace Management (Priority: Medium)**
|
||||
|
||||
**Target:** Week of September 2, 2025
|
||||
|
||||
**Tools to Implement:**
|
||||
|
||||
- `vscode_find_in_files` - Search across workspace with regex support
|
||||
- `vscode_find_symbols` - Find symbols in workspace
|
||||
- `vscode_goto_line` - Navigate to specific line/column
|
||||
- `vscode_reveal_in_explorer` - Show file in explorer
|
||||
- `vscode_open_folder` - Open workspace folder
|
||||
- `vscode_close_folder` - Close workspace folder
|
||||
- `vscode_switch_editor_tab` - Switch between open files
|
||||
|
||||
**Value:** Enables agents to navigate and understand large codebases
|
||||
|
||||
#### **Phase 4: Terminal & Process Management (Priority: Medium)**
|
||||
|
||||
**Target:** Week of September 9, 2025
|
||||
|
||||
**Tools to Implement:**
|
||||
|
||||
- `vscode_create_terminal` - Create new terminal instance
|
||||
- `vscode_send_to_terminal` - Send commands to terminal
|
||||
- `vscode_get_terminal_output` - Get terminal output (if possible via API)
|
||||
- `vscode_close_terminal` - Close terminal instances
|
||||
- `vscode_run_task` - Execute VS Code tasks (build, test, etc.)
|
||||
- `vscode_get_tasks` - List available tasks
|
||||
- `vscode_stop_task` - Stop running task
|
||||
|
||||
**Value:** Enables agents to manage build processes and execute commands
|
||||
|
||||
#### **Phase 5: Git & Version Control Integration (Priority: High)**
|
||||
|
||||
**Target:** Week of September 16, 2025
|
||||
|
||||
**Tools to Implement:**
|
||||
|
||||
- `vscode_git_status` - Get repository status
|
||||
- `vscode_git_commit` - Create commits with messages
|
||||
- `vscode_git_push` - Push changes to remote
|
||||
- `vscode_git_pull` - Pull changes from remote
|
||||
- `vscode_git_branch` - Branch operations (create, switch, delete)
|
||||
- `vscode_git_diff` - Get file differences
|
||||
- `vscode_git_stage` - Stage/unstage files
|
||||
- `vscode_git_blame` - Get blame information
|
||||
|
||||
**Value:** Enables agents to manage version control workflows
|
||||
|
||||
#### **Phase 6: Advanced Features & Extension Management (Priority: Low)**
|
||||
|
||||
**Target:** Week of September 23, 2025
|
||||
|
||||
**Tools to Implement:**
|
||||
|
||||
- `vscode_get_settings` - Get VS Code settings
|
||||
- `vscode_update_settings` - Update settings
|
||||
- `vscode_get_extensions` - List installed extensions
|
||||
- `vscode_install_extension` - Install extensions (if permitted)
|
||||
- `vscode_debug_start` - Start debugging session
|
||||
- `vscode_debug_stop` - Stop debugging
|
||||
- `vscode_set_breakpoint` - Set/remove breakpoints
|
||||
|
||||
**Value:** Complete IDE automation capabilities
